Lost Control (Grinspoon song)

"Lost Control" is a song by Grinspoon. It was released on 12 May 2002,[1] as the second single from their third studio album, New Detention, and peaked at No. 29 on the ARIA Singles Chart.[2][3] It also reached No. 14 on Triple J's Hottest 100 in 2002.[4] The video shows a woman driving to a Grinspoon concert at Bondi beach,[5] where the fans cause chaos. It is the official theme song for AFL Live 2004.
